Issuance of licence
36(1)On application in accordance with the regulations, the Registrar may issue a fish buying licence to any person.
36(2)A fish buying licence is valid for the period of time prescribed by regulation.
2013, c.22, s.4

Issuance of licence
36(1)The Registrar
(a) shall, on the issuance of a primary processing plant licence or live lobster holding facility licence, also issue a fish purchaser licence to the licensee, and
(b) may, on application in accordance with the regulations, issue a fish purchaser licence to the following persons:
(i) an owner or lessee of a primary processing plant located in another province or territory of Canada who holds a certificate of registration under the Fish Inspection Act (Canada);
(ii) an owner or lessee of a live lobster holding facility located in another province or territory of Canada and whose facility is capable of holding the minimum amount of lobster prescribed by regulation; or
(iii) a person who is a resident of a foreign country and whose fish processing plant meets the standards relating to food safety required by that country if the standards are equivalent to or greater than Canadian standards relating to food safety.
36(2)A fish purchaser licence is valid for the period of time prescribed by regulation.
